Manuel Tagle valued on La Voz En Vivo the decision to reduce taxes and described the announcement as "a real announcement about the economy, about tax reduction." He also stated that the country is heading toward "an inexorable economic opening", which, according to his words, means listening to the voice of businesspeople.

The president of the Stock Exchange indicated that tax burdens must be reviewed to stimulate investment and strengthen private activity. He emphasized that regulatory and tax stability is a key factor for productive planning and sustained development.

Tagle stressed that tax improvements provide direct relief to society, increasing saving and consumption capacity. These statements show the importance he assigns to fiscal measures that have a concrete impact on the real economy.

Competition and industrial modernization

In the interview, the businessman pointed out that "opening and competition strengthen companies" and make it possible to raise quality standards. He reaffirmed that creating appropriate incentives is key to stimulating innovation and productive effort.

The Argentine economic context, marked by decades of protectionism, raises the need for industry to adapt to a competitive environment. Tagle's position underscores that measures such as tax reduction and clear rules are necessary for this process.

The agenda proposed by Tagle places the consumer at the center of the productive system, with more competitive prices and options. This allows one to infer, from a journalistic analysis, that a more efficient economy can directly improve the quality of life of society.

Implications for the Cordoban economy

Tagle also highlighted that a competitive environment with a lower tax burden can boost investment and industrial activity. He indicated that coordination between fiscal rules and competitiveness is decisive for regional and national growth.

The president of the Stock Exchange assured that credit is an essential instrument for generating social equality and stressed that historical tax pressure has limited its development. The vision he presents points to a more orderly economy capable of generating sustainable opportunities.

Finally, Tagle stated that the policy implemented is aligned with an economic opening that favors industrial modernization. This approach reinforces the need for a stable and competitive fiscal framework, a condition that allows companies and citizens to plan with certainty.
